WAGES v. WAGES


38 A.D.2d 968 (1972)

Arthur H. Wages, Respondent, v. Arlene J. Wages,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

March 20, 1972


Judgment affirmed insofar as appealed from, without costs.

In our opinion, the Special Term, under the circumstances of this case, had the power to direct the sale of the marital home and to provide for ultimate division of the proceeds of the sale (Domestic Relations Law, § 234; Pearson v.
